Herd turnout: Herd turnout is an important part of a horse's development. It allows a horse to gain social skills, become confindent and sure about themselves, as well as becoming competitive amoung other horses. These are all important trates for a race horse to acquire in order to become successful in their training and eventually on the track:

Breaking horses from the very beginning allows for them to begin to enjoy learning and gain trust for humans. A good foundation will also aid in breaking as a yearling to a harness and aid in developing a mentally sound race horse. Our wenlings are also on a regular worming and vacs program.

Swimming is a great alternative exercise for some horses. It provides both a therapy and a cardio fitness workout in one. Horses enjoy the daily walk down our wood chip track to and from our pond for their daily swim. We offer day, short term, and long term swimming. With our large floating dock, horses are able to swim in our 18 ft deep pond.
